summaryrefslogtreecommitdiff
path: root/doc/latex/keyDerivation_8h.tex
diff options
context:
space:
mode:
Diffstat (limited to 'doc/latex/keyDerivation_8h.tex')
-rw-r--r--doc/latex/keyDerivation_8h.tex53
1 files changed, 53 insertions, 0 deletions
diff --git a/doc/latex/keyDerivation_8h.tex b/doc/latex/keyDerivation_8h.tex
new file mode 100644
index 0000000..1dc84ca
--- /dev/null
+++ b/doc/latex/keyDerivation_8h.tex
@@ -0,0 +1,53 @@
+\section{key\-Derivation.h File Reference}
+\label{keyDerivation_8h}\index{keyDerivation.h@{keyDerivation.h}}
+{\tt \#include \char`\"{}datatypes.h\char`\"{}}\par
+{\tt \#include \char`\"{}buffer.h\char`\"{}}\par
+{\tt \#include $<$string$>$}\par
+{\tt \#include $<$srtp/crypto\_\-kernel.h$>$}\par
+{\tt \#include $<$gcrypt.h$>$}\par
+\subsection*{Classes}
+\begin{CompactItemize}
+\item
+class {\bf Key\-Derivation}
+\end{CompactItemize}
+\subsection*{Enumerations}
+\begin{CompactItemize}
+\item
+enum {\bf satp\_\-prf\_\-label} \{ {\bf label\_\-satp\_\-encryption} = 0x00,
+{\bf label\_\-satp\_\-msg\_\-auth} = 0x01,
+{\bf label\_\-satp\_\-salt} = 0x02
+ \}
+\end{CompactItemize}
+\subsection*{Variables}
+\begin{CompactItemize}
+\item
+const std::string {\bf MIN\_\-GCRYPT\_\-VERSION} = \char`\"{}1.2.3\char`\"{}
+\end{CompactItemize}
+
+
+\subsection{Enumeration Type Documentation}
+\index{keyDerivation.h@{key\-Derivation.h}!satp_prf_label@{satp\_\-prf\_\-label}}
+\index{satp_prf_label@{satp\_\-prf\_\-label}!keyDerivation.h@{key\-Derivation.h}}
+\subsubsection{\setlength{\rightskip}{0pt plus 5cm}enum {\bf satp\_\-prf\_\-label}}\label{keyDerivation_8h_4829fcd87054af9b3ced79bbac1ce1eb}
+
+
+\begin{Desc}
+\item[Enumerator: ]\par
+\begin{description}
+\index{label_satp_encryption@{label\_\-satp\_\-encryption}!keyDerivation.h@{keyDerivation.h}}\index{keyDerivation.h@{keyDerivation.h}!label_satp_encryption@{label\_\-satp\_\-encryption}}\item[{\em
+label\_\-satp\_\-encryption\label{keyDerivation_8h_4829fcd87054af9b3ced79bbac1ce1eb4cece0d357861fb1d1b4087f05284543}
+}]\index{label_satp_msg_auth@{label\_\-satp\_\-msg\_\-auth}!keyDerivation.h@{keyDerivation.h}}\index{keyDerivation.h@{keyDerivation.h}!label_satp_msg_auth@{label\_\-satp\_\-msg\_\-auth}}\item[{\em
+label\_\-satp\_\-msg\_\-auth\label{keyDerivation_8h_4829fcd87054af9b3ced79bbac1ce1ebd45276cca55df72c149b44bbf80757c3}
+}]\index{label_satp_salt@{label\_\-satp\_\-salt}!keyDerivation.h@{keyDerivation.h}}\index{keyDerivation.h@{keyDerivation.h}!label_satp_salt@{label\_\-satp\_\-salt}}\item[{\em
+label\_\-satp\_\-salt\label{keyDerivation_8h_4829fcd87054af9b3ced79bbac1ce1eb78eb4c963e5ca87676c0a713e2fd9aa4}
+}]\end{description}
+\end{Desc}
+
+
+
+\subsection{Variable Documentation}
+\index{keyDerivation.h@{key\-Derivation.h}!MIN_GCRYPT_VERSION@{MIN\_\-GCRYPT\_\-VERSION}}
+\index{MIN_GCRYPT_VERSION@{MIN\_\-GCRYPT\_\-VERSION}!keyDerivation.h@{key\-Derivation.h}}
+\subsubsection{\setlength{\rightskip}{0pt plus 5cm}const std::string {\bf MIN\_\-GCRYPT\_\-VERSION} = \char`\"{}1.2.3\char`\"{}}\label{keyDerivation_8h_6dcd6ca1447ccea53a7975c2a18f6a83}
+
+